Falcon LogScale is ranked 34th in Log Management with 1 review while Splunk Enterprise Security is ranked 1st in Log Management with 244 reviews. Falcon LogScale is rated 9.0, while Splunk Enterprise Security is rated 8.4. The top reviewer of Falcon LogScale writes "A highly commendable and robust solution offering powerful features and comprehensive log data management".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Splunk Enterprise Security writes "It has a drag-and-drop interface, so you don't need to know SQL or Java to construct a query ". Falcon LogScale is most compared with Elastic Stack, Grafana Loki, LogRhythm SIEM, Exabeam Fusion SIEM and Sumo Logic Security, whereas Splunk Enterprise Security is most compared with Wazuh, Dynatrace, IBM Security QRadar, Elastic Security and Microsoft Sentinel.
